Three Hole Punch Jim Costume

The ultimate low-effort, high-recognition Halloween costume for fans of The Office.

Three Hole Punch Jim is Jim Halpert's iconic, low-effort Halloween costume from Season 2 of The Office. It is a favorite for fans who want a clever, recognizable, and incredibly comfortable outfit. The look consists of standard office attire decorated with three simple black paper circles.

What you need for a Three Hole Punch Jim costume

  • White dress shirt

    A classic long-sleeved white button-down dress shirt, worn with the sleeves casually rolled up to the forearms.

    DIY: Use any plain white dress shirt already in your closet.

  • Black necktie

    A standard matte black necktie, tied in a simple knot.

    DIY: Use a black fabric marker on a cheap light-colored tie if desperate, or borrow one.

  • Black paper circles

    Three circular cutouts, approximately 3 to 4 inches in diameter, made from black cardstock or stiff felt.

    DIY: Cut three circles out of black construction paper or cardstock and attach them with double-sided tape or safety pins.

  • Dark dress pants

    Standard gray, charcoal, or black flat-front dress pants.

    DIY: Any dark-colored slacks or chinos will work.

  • Black leather belt

    A simple black leather belt with a silver buckle.

How to put it together

  1. 1

    Put on the white button-down dress shirt and button it up completely, leaving only the top collar button open.

  2. 2

    Put on the dark dress pants and secure them with the black leather belt.

  3. 3

    Tie the black necktie around your collar, keeping it slightly loose for Jim's relaxed look.

  4. 4

    Roll the sleeves of the white shirt up to your mid-forearms.

  5. 5

    Cut three identical circles (about 3.5 inches wide) from black paper or felt.

  6. 6

    Attach the three circles vertically down the right side of your shirt chest using double-sided tape, safety pins, or fabric-safe adhesive.

Makeup & hair

Style your hair in a messy, shaggy 2000s side-parted mop-top. No makeup is required, but a classic deadpan stare into the camera completes the look.

Tips

  • Use double-sided carpet tape or safety pins from the inside of the shirt to ensure the black circles don't fall off during the night.
  • Keep your hands in your pockets and practice your best 'staring blankly at the camera' face for photos.
  • This is an excellent last-minute costume since most people already own the base clothing items.

Three Hole Punch Jim costume FAQ

Which side do the three holes go on?
In the show, Jim places the three black circles on his right side (the viewer's left when looking at him).
What episode does Jim wear the 3 hole punch costume?
Jim wears this costume in Season 2, Episode 5 of The Office, titled 'Halloween'.
How big should the black circles be?
They should be about 3 to 4 inches in diameter to look proportional on a standard dress shirt.

Did you know? Jim Halpert chose this costume because he famously hates dressing up for Halloween, making it the perfect meta-joke for low-effort costume seekers.
